Keith County Chamber Of Commerce
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 373,649 | 383,782 | −10,133 | 2.7 | 40% |
| 2012 | 403,156 | 377,078 | 26,078 | 3.1 | 36% |
| 2013 | 441,112 | 444,375 | −3,263 | 2.5 | 29% |
| 2014 | 435,555 | 441,576 | −6,021 | 2.4 | 27% |
| 2015 | 441,712 | 437,907 | 3,805 | 2.5 | 26% |
| 2016 | 481,226 | 509,835 | −28,609 | 1.5 | 29% |
| 2017 | 300,164 | 287,056 | 13,108 | 3.2 | 32% |
| 2018 | 270,452 | 307,232 | −36,780 | 1.5 | 28% |
| 2019 | 352,089 | 362,281 | −10,192 | 1.0 | 24% |
| 2020 | 372,255 | 377,056 | −4,801 | 0.8 | 28% |
| 2021 | 437,439 | 432,315 | 5,124 | 0.8 | 26% |
| 2022 | 321,437 | 290,734 | 30,703 | 2.5 | 29% |
In its most recent public year (2022), this organization brought in $30,703 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 2.5 months of spending. Staff pay was 29%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2022.
